About The Position

Edu-Tech Academic Solutions is seeking a proactive, hands-on Director of Technology for a partner independent school serving students in grades 9-12. This leadership role is responsible for the development, management, and evaluation of all information technology services supporting learning and administration. The Director oversees core technology infrastructure, including networks, servers, and cybersecurity, while leading technology budgeting and strategic planning. The Director supervises information IT staff and serves as an integral member of the team to accomplish both the daily operations and long-term institutional goals.

Responsibilities

  • Establish and articulate a vision for technology use guided by the school's mission and strategic plan.
  • Directly supervise, coach, and mentor IT staff to create a collaborative and harmonious work environment.
  • Project and plan the school's annual capital and operating technology budgets, including 5-year replacement cycles.
  • Partner with senior administrators and academic department heads to research and implement emerging technologies.
  • Manage mission-critical platforms, including PowerSchool (SIS), Schoology (LMS), Google Workspace for Education, and FinalSite.
  • Lead cybersecurity efforts, including protecting digital assets, implementing cybersecurity training for faculty and staff, and ensuring regulatory compliance.
  • Develop and assess disaster recovery and business continuity plans.
  • Coordinate and support facilities staff with on-campus systems, including Public Address (PA), bells/clocks, and security systems.
  • Ensure timely and effective responses to all tech support requests; participate as an active member of the support team for Tier 2 and Tier 3 issues.
  • Maintain asset tracking for all hardware and manage contracts/licensing with technology vendors.
  • Establish and update standard operating procedures (SOPs) and comprehensive system documentation.
  • Perform ongoing auditing and remediation of all IT policies and procedures to ensure they meet the school's evolving needs.
